Output 3d25fea86ead8ea78446186ad2eb4a87c6d6ccc2e150439280ab4735e5a9a7e7:0

value
78415000
script pubkey
OP_0 OP_PUSHBYTES_20 8de14c598c421b7d2962074ca0dd6fab5d5303a8
address
bc1q3hs5ckvvggdh62tzqax2pht04dw4xqagqerujm
transaction
3d25fea86ead8ea78446186ad2eb4a87c6d6ccc2e150439280ab4735e5a9a7e7
confirmations
329153
spent
true